Why Is Attracting Talent Hard?

Many businesses battle to attract top-tier talent. Frequent hurdles companies face include:

  • Skills shortage: You may be in an industry where qualified talent is in high demand and short supply, increasing competition for top talent
  • Employee needs: A shift in employee needs means businesses must go beyond 401(k) contributions and health insurance to attract talent. Companies are expected to be creative with their benefits
  • Candidate experience: Companies are judged based on their interactions with talent. Everything from the ease of submitting applications to the level of communication through the interviewing process to the clarity of the job description is vital. Many businesses fall short of candidate expectations

How to Hire Top Talent

As your company grows, finding the right people to help you expand is essential. Training and developing your hiring team to attract and retain the right talent is a game changer.

  • Clarifying the role and requirements: Your team must clearly understand what your organization values in top talent
  • Writing clear job descriptions: The hiring team should address top talent’s needs and desires and construct straightforward job descriptions
  • Optimizing recruitment channels: Developing and implementing multiple strategies is vital. Your team should use innovative approaches to reach talented individuals
  • Mastering the interview process: This is the make-or-break point of hiring top talent. Your hiring team needs to ask valuable questions and be strategic to identify and acquire the best talent

Hiring top talent involves investing in your human resource and talent development teams. Empower your team to attract, acquire and retain the best talent.
